Overview

The Patient Diagnosis Liaison (PDL) DACH will report to the Associate Medical Director of the DACH (Germany, Switzerland and Austria) Cluster and will mostly be responsible for identifying HCPs (Health Care Professionals) in the cluster who care for patients with rare diseases through face-to-face scientific engagement.

In Short

  • Identify, establish and/or maintain scientific relationships with KOLs and/or HCPs who care for patients with rare diseases.
  • Assist HCPs with rare disease patient identification by creating disease state awareness and educating on diagnosing these patients for potential enrollment into Ultragenyx’ clinical trial programs.
  • Collaborate with the Clinical Operations organization to enhance patient enrolment in Ultragenyx’ clinical trial programs.
  • Perform activities to increase awareness of the rare diseases of Ultragenyx interest.
  • Provide clinical presentations and information in response to unsolicited questions.
  • Provide scientific and medical information updates and scientific support at medical congresses.
  • Manage responses to EMEA patient inquiries related to clinical trials.
  • Capture and maintain data within our CRM system and collect medical insights.
  • Occasional support to specific PDL activities in other regions.

Requirements

  • Advanced degree in clinical specialty required (MD, PhD, PharmD, Master of Science Degree).
  • 3-5 years of medical field experience in Pharmaceutical Industry.
  • Rare disease experience is essential, particularly genetic disorders.
  • Demonstrated experience effectively presenting clinical/scientific information.
  • Fluent in German and English.
  • Approximately 50-60% travel is required.
